Job Title: Programme Manager - Partners and Mentorship, Karo Kura
Reporting Lines: Reports to the Senior Programme Manager
Location: Freetown, with regular visits to the Provinces
Contract: 2.5 years Fixed Contract (Subject to Probationary Period)
The Programme Manager plays a central role in the execution of programme strategy designed to achieve Purposeful’s mission. This includes responsibility for developing partnerships with grassroots organisations and making funding recommendations to the Board of Directors; supporting the organisational development of grantee-partners through supportive interactions; and documenting the lessons learned in supporting community-driven change. The role also require supporting all mentorship and life skills activities with partners.
In order to execute their responsibilities effectively, the Programme Manager must maintain an in-depth knowledge of the priorities and strategies of Purposeful grant-making, learning and evaluation, as well as advocacy programmes and develop a deep knowledge around adolescent girls.
PARTNERSHIPS MANAGEMENT
- Manage grant-making for a cohort of partners by conducting the required due diligence to make funding recommendations to the Board of Directors
- Provide technical support and guidance to partners in developing budgets and implementation plans; monitor implementation of programmes, paying attention to efficacy of programmes to achieve stated goals
- Support partners to meet both financial and narrative reporting requirements
- Conduct quarterly support visits to understand context, partner strengths and challenges, and to support and monitor implementation of programmes
- Collaborate with other team members in the assessment of partner capacity and in planning accompaniment strategies
- Accompany grantee-partners in their organisational development by identifying and using effective approaches, tools, and opportunities
- Facilitates opportunities to network grantee-partners for sharing, learning and collaboration
- Document activities and shares effective practices across grantee partners and across portfolios.
PROGRAMME MANAGEMENT: EMPOWERING ADOLESCENT GIRLS
- Oversee the planning, coordination, and implementation of adolescent girls’ empowerment programme
- Develop creative strategies for effective and engaged delivery of programming to build up girls’ power and assets
- Assess strengths, gaps and needs within partner teams and design appropriate training, mentoring, and peer support strategies to build up local knowledge, skills, and competencies
- Provide ongoing mentoring, training and technical support of Karo Kura partners to develop a sound understanding of adolescent girls’ empowerment and girl-centered programming
- Participate in both formal and informal sessions with adolescent girls to understand their strengths, needs, and challenges in order to design programming that responds to their lived reality
- Engage with mentors to understand their needs and capabilities and design support tailored to meet the appropriate type and level of support needed
- As part of Purposeful’s National Mentors Training Academy, manage and coordinate the training of mentors across Karo Kura partners, ensuring ongoing improvement in their delivery of life skills programming for adolescent girls
- Conduct support visits to safe spaces to monitor quality of delivery, fidelity to core principles, and adaptation to local context
- Support partners to develop strong links with community leaders and service providers, addressing access to education, health, and protection for adolescent girls.
